HitBTC adds support of cryptocurrency Siacoin

Cryptocurrency trading platform HitBTC has announced that it has added the cryptocurrency Siacoin as a member to its exchange.

Siacoin is one of the most prominent members of the top-25 digital currencies with the market capitalization of $9 million, at press time. According to the digital currency platform, SС/BTC market is already available on HitBTC.

The official blog stated that Sia represents a peer-to-peer network consisting of various hard drives that are connected to the united network globally. Being an actively developed decentralized storage platform, Sia network is cryptographically secured and it uses the cryptocurrency – Siacoin.

“The Siacoin cryptocurrency is a crucial part of the network since all storage contracts and payment channels require having digital coins. Roughly, this means that the Siacoin price will be increasing together with the adoption of the network itself. The Siacoin’s value is tied to the amount of used Storage on the network. Siacoin’s market capitalization has already surpassed $9,000,000, affected by a rapid growth in the middle of June 2016,” the blog post stated.

Unlike other cloud storage services like Amazon and Dropbox, the decentralized storage platform Sia leverages blockchain technology in order to reach consensus in a secure way. Sia plans to replace Bittorrent, Microsoft OneDrive, and all backend cloud storage services, in a move to become a strong storage layer of the internet. This can be achieved by the appearance of small decentralized data centers that has fastest, cheapest, and the most secure cloud storage platform.

Sia helps these small and efficient data centers to sell their storage without market trust. Sia also minimizes the barrier to entry and thus creates a wealth of cheap storage for its users.
